What it actually says
Audio Review
Post-implementation reviewer for Godot audio code. Checks against known gotchas that LLMs consistently get wrong.
When to trigger
After audio-related code is written or modified. Look for:
- Audio player nodes (AudioStreamPlayer, AudioStreamPlayer2D, AudioStreamPlayer3D)
- AudioServer bus manipulation (
add_bus,remove_bus,add_bus_effect,remove_bus_effect) preload()of.oggor.mp3filesfinishedsignal connections orawait .finishedon audio players- Polyphony configuration or SFX pooling patterns
Review process
- Read
gotchas.md - Scan the implemented code against each gotcha
- For each hit:
- Cite the gotcha ID (e.g. G1)
- Show the offending code
- Provide the fix
- If no hits, report clean
- Optionally run
checklist.mdstatic checks for automated verification
When you need specific API details, delegate to the godot-api skill.
